Kansas City man to spend decade in prison after lethal amount of fentanyl found

KANSAS CITY, Mo. (KCTV) – A Kansas City man will spend a decade in prison after a lethal amount of fentanyl was found in his possession.

The U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Western District of Missouri says that Lawrence A. Andrews, 51, of Kansas City, has been sentenced to prison for trafficking fentanyl.

Court documents noted that on March 4, Andrews pleaded guilty to possession with intent to distribute fentanyl and possession of a firearm in furtherance of a drug trafficking crime. He admitted that he possessed 19 grams of fentanyl and a 9mm pistol on Aug. 8, 2023…
